In Missouri, you can obtain a certified copy of a death certificate if you can show that you have a "direct and tangible interest" in the record. In Missouri, a death certificate must be filed with the local registrar within five days and before final disposition of the body. Missouri regulations require a body to be embalmed or refrigerated if final disposition does not occur within 24 hours. Suppose you wish to scatter ashes in uninhabited public rural lands. Any type of remains, including ashes, can only be placed in the ocean 3 nautical miles from land or more. If the container will not easily decompose, you must dispose of it separately.
